12. Describe the purpose of the cervix prior to ovulation.: Just prior to ovulation, the
cervix swells, softens and secretes mucus allowing sperm better access to and viability
within the uterus.
13. Describe the purpose of the cervix during pregnancy.: To begin pregnancy, the
cervix
produces a thick fluid that increases the viability of the sperm. The cervix provides a seal
to keep foreign objects from reaching the fetus. During labor, the uterus will contract, and
the baby's head will push on the mother's cervix. When the cervix is dilated to 10mm, the
mother begins pushing and delivers the baby.
